Everyone is talking about AI these days. But what exactly is AI? How did it evolve? And what potential does it have to influence the future? This lecture takes you on a rollercoaster ride looking at the extraordinary – but often somewhat terrifying – potential of what is arguably the most significant invention of humankind.

The lecture concludes that we are about to face radically different form of intelligence-and alien intelligence-that will far exceed human intelligence, and completely transform the discipline of architecture. 

Design Matters National is excited to host British architect, professor and author Neil Leach in Sydney to speak on AI's impact on building designers, architects and other built environment professionals. 

This event will be hosted by Danielle Johnston, CEO, Design Matters National, Australia's largest and fastest growing peak body for Building Designers and Energy Efficiency Assessors.  

We look forward to welcoming you to Brickworks Design Studio Sydney for networking, an insightful lecture, and Q&A, shared with like-minded people over a light lunch.
